Corporate Registries is the Northwest Territories register of territorial incorporations, extra-territorial registrations, societies, co-operative associations, partnerships and business names, administered by the territorial Department of Justice. Basic entity information is available at no charge through the Corporate Registries Online System.

Public access
Partly open The territory states that basic information such as legal name, status and entity type is available free of charge, and that an account with a card on file is required only for a full entity profile.
The territory states that "Basic information such as the legal name, status, and type of entity is available free of charge".
Entity profiles link to scanned images of the documents an organisation has filed, so the underlying record is reachable.
One register covers territorial incorporations, extra-territorial registrations, societies, co-operatives, partnerships and business names.
The territory publishes its certificate fees openly, at $20.00 for a certificate of compliance or good standing.
Limitations
A full entity profile requires an account with a valid Visa or Mastercard on file to pre-authorise funds.
It records territorial registration and does not establish federal incorporation.
Some of the published guidance documents are several years old, the oldest dating from 2015.

Best for
Confirming free of charge that a Northwest Territories entity exists and what its current status is.
Reaching scanned images of documents a Northwest Territories entity has filed.
Not recommended for
Confirming federal incorporation, which is recorded by Corporations Canada rather than by the territory.
Obtaining a full entity profile without paying, because that requires an account with a card on file.
